Angiotech Sells Interventional Business To Argon Medical Devices
This article was originally published in The Pink Sheet Daily
Executive Summary
The deal will allow Angiotech to pay off all of its debt obligations and will bring the interventional products business, which includes biopsy devices and drainage catheters, back to its former owners.
